How Mining Works
How mining actually works is an intricate dance of technology, mathematics, and economics. Transactions made in the cryptocurrency network are collected by miners into blocks. Each block contains a hash of the previous block, ensuring chronological order and data integrity. When a miner successfully solves the block's puzzle, the block is added to the blockchain, and the miner receives a block reward.
Miners generally opt for specific algorithms according to the cryptocurrency they wish to mine. For example, Bitcoin uses the SHA-256 algorithm, while Ethereum utilizes Ethash. Depending on the currency, the mining process can either involve significant energy consumption or be relatively light on power requirements, shaping the overall mining strategy.
Types of Mining
Cryptocurrency enthusiasts have various options when it comes to mining, and these can be broadly categorized into three distinctive types: Solo Mining, Pool Mining, and Cloud Mining.
Solo Mining
Solo mining refers to the practice where an individual miner uses their resources to mine a cryptocurrency independently. One of the key characteristics of solo mining is the independence it confers. Miners in this category rely entirely on their hardware and skills to solve cryptographic puzzles. It can be a double-edged sword — while the potential rewards are high since all mined coins go directly to the miner, the competition makes it less feasible for individuals without significant computational power. The unique feature here is that the rewards can be alluring for those who have specialized equipment yet, the disadvantage is that success rates are lower compared to collective efforts.
Pool Mining
Conversely, pool mining allows miners to join together, pooling their resources to tackle the mining puzzle collectively. The key quality of pool mining lies in its collaborative effort. This method reduces the time it takes to earn rewards, as the group shares the computing power, leading to a higher chance of successfully mining a block. Once a block is mined, rewards are distributed proportionally based on contribution. The downside here is that individual rewards are significantly smaller compared to solo mining since they’re split among all pool participants. However, for many, the stability of earning some returns regularly is far more appealing than the uncertainty of solo efforts.
Cloud Mining
Cloud mining takes a more modern approach. It allows individuals to rent mining power from a third party, essentially outsourcing the hardware and maintenance aspects. The key characteristic of cloud mining is its accessibility. Users can mine without needing to invest in expensive hardware or deal with the technical complexities involved. A noteworthy feature is that contracts can vary in duration and cost, allowing miners to tailor their involvement. However, the trade-off is that profit margins can be lower, and it introduces a level of trust in the service provider, as miners must rely on them to fulfill the terms of their contract safely.

Mining Difficulty
Mining difficulty is perhaps one of the most pivotal factors impacting profitability. It refers to how hard it is to find a new block in the blockchain. As more miners enter the fray, the difficulty ramps up, making it a steeper hill to climb for new entrants. This increase can be viewed on many platforms in real-time, creating a competitive environment where only the most efficient miners can thrive.
It's important to stay updated on how often this difficulty adjusts, as it directly impacts mining outcomes and potential earnings. If you're just starting out, entering during a time of lower difficulty can significantly enhance profitability.

Hardware Efficiency
The efficiency of the mining hardware also heavily influences a miner's profit margin. When choosing between different types of miners, one must consider both initial costs and operational efficiency. Two primary contenders in the mining sphere are ASIC miners and GPU miners.
ASIC Miners


ASIC (Application-Specific Integrated Circuit) miners are purpose-built machines designed for specific mining activities. Their standout feature is their high efficiency compared to general-purpose equipment. Typically, these hardware pieces extract the maximum hashing power from minimal electricity use.
A major benefit of ASIC miners is speed; they can solve complex mathematical problems with unmatched efficiency. However, this comes with a notable downside: they can cost a pretty penny upfront and may not be versatile enough if the mining landscape shifts dramatically.
GPU Miners
On the other hand, GPU miners (Graphical Processing Units) are known for their flexibility. They can mine various cryptocurrencies because they aren't tied to a single algorithm. While they may not be as powerful as ASIC miners in terms of raw speed, they can still perform exceptionally well in many scenarios, particularly when mining lesser-known altcoins.
However, GPU miners also tend to consume more electricity and can require greater setup and maintenance for optimal performance. Essentially, the choice between ASIC and GPU can be a balancing act of budget, flexibility, and long-term vision for mining endeavors.

Bitcoin
Bitcoin, the pioneer of the cryptocurrency world, remains a heavyweight in mining profitability. With its vast network and established market cap, miners flock to it for its potential returns. However, the associated mining difficulty has escalated significantly since its inception. Today, to successfully mine Bitcoin, one typically requires specialized ASIC miners, which are designed to perform one task—mining Bitcoin—at maximum efficiency. In essence, this specialization is both a boon and a barrier; while it assures a higher chance of success for dedicated setups, it can deter newcomers lacking the resources. Furthermore, another aspect worth mentioning is the halving event. Occurring approximately every four years, it reduces the reward for mining blocks, influencing not just supply but market demand as well. Those interested in mining Bitcoin must prepare for these market intricacies.

Litecoin
Litecoin, often seen as the silver to Bitcoin’s gold, brings a unique approach due to its quicker block generation time. This results in quicker transactions, which can provide miners with an opportunity to secure rewards more frequently. Mining Litecoin uses an algorithm called Scrypt, which is accessible to a wider range of mining hardware, including consumer-grade graphics cards. This accessibility gives it an edge, particularly for miners who wish to diversify their portfolios beyond Bitcoin. However, the market for Litecoin can be volatile, and miners should remain vigilant about price movements and assess the ongoing profitability based on their specific mining setup and energy costs.
Ravencoin
Ravencoin has gained traction for its focus on asset transfer and the simplicity it offers to its users. Unlike many other cryptocurrencies, Ravencoin operates on a proof of work model that is intentionally designed to be ASIC resistant. This means that standard GPUs can participate in the mining process, making it an attractive option for those who want to avoid the hefty investment typically associated with ASICs. Furthermore, the community-driven approach of Ravencoin contributes to its growing popularity, allowing miners a sense of involvement in its development. However, potential miners should keep an eye on market trends and overall demand, as these factors will invariably play a role in profitability.
Monero
Finally, there’s Monero, a cryptocurrency that has carved out a niche known for its emphasis on privacy and anonymity. The mining process for Monero is distinct; it utilizes the RandomX proof of work algorithm, making it particularly friendly to CPU miners. This opens up mining opportunities to a more significant number of potential participants, particularly those who may not have substantial capital to invest in high-end GPUs or ASIC miners. The allure of privacy-centric features has carved out a unique market for Monero, but as always, miners need to analyze factors like hardware efficiency and increasing competition within the network.

Advantages of Mining Pools
Mining pools aggregate the power and resources of multiple miners, creating a robust network that can tackle complex computations more efficiently than an individual miner alone. Below are some significant advantages:


- Consistent Rewards: Instead of waiting for a long time to solve a block, which can be the case in solo mining, pools distribute rewards among participants regularly. This leads to more consistent income streams.
- Lower Variability: The variance in earnings is significantly reduced. Depending on the pool size and payout schedule, miners can expect smaller, but regular payouts instead of the hit-or-miss nature of solo mining.
- Shared Resources and Support: Being part of a mining pool often means access to better equipment and technology resources that might be too costly for a solo miner.
- Collaborative Security: Pools enhance the likelihood of maintaining block validation and lessen the risk of attacks, which can be a concern for individual miners.
Mining pools can provide a safety net for newcomers who might otherwise feel overwhelmed by the daunting challenges of solo mining.
Disadvantages of Mining Pools
Though there are many upsides, being part of a mining pool is not without its downsides. It's worth weighing these disadvantages carefully:
- Fees and Charges: Most pools charge fees for their services, which can eat into overall profits. This is usually a percentage of the mined rewards, and while it helps keep the pool operational, it also reduces potential earnings for individual miners.
- Less Control: Joining a pool means giving up some degree of control over mining strategies and decisions, as the pool's policies dictate much of the operational flow. Miners do not get to choose which blocks to mine directly.
- Pool Risks: If a mining pool is poorly managed or becomes a target of cybercriminals, miners could potentially lose their investments. Trusting a pool with your resources can be risky.

Using Mining Calculators
Mining calculators are essential tools for anyone serious about assessing the profitability of their mining operations. They essentially take a plethora of variables into account, allowing miners to make informed decisions without having to rely solely on guesswork. Most of these calculators require inputs such as hash rate, electricity cost, and pool fees to churn out potential earnings.
- Hash Rate: This indicates the speed at which your mining hardware operates. Higher hash rates typically lead to higher potential earnings.
- Electricity Cost: This is a critical input, as mining can consume a considerable amount of energy.
- Pool Fees: If you’re involved in pool mining, understanding the cut taken by the pool is crucial for calculating the net profit.
To illustrate,
"If your mining rig has a hash rate of 100 MH/s with electricity costing $0.10 per kWh and the pool charges a 1% fee, then a mining calculator can show you potential daily profits, taking all these factors into account."
Such insights are invaluable, as they help miners capitalize on their efforts without falling short on budgetary requirements. Popular calculators such as WhatToMine and CryptoCompare can provide assistance in navigating these figures.
Understanding ROI
Return on Investment, or ROI, is a term that carries a lot of weight in the world of mining. In a nutshell, ROI measures the profitability of an investment relative to its cost. For miners, understanding ROI helps in evaluating whether the upfront investment in hardware and continuous operational costs will deliver a reasonable return over a specific period.
A few considerations to keep in mind:
- Initial Setup Costs: Assess how much you plan to spend on your mining setup—this includes hardware, software, and cooling solutions.
- Operational Costs: From electricity bills to maintenance, ongoing costs mustn’t be ignored when calculating ROI.
- Market Trends: Fluctuations in cryptocurrency prices can wildly affect your returns; it pays to stay informed about the market.
For instance, if you have invested $1,000 in a miner and over six months you’ve earned $600 in profits, your ROI would be 60%.
